The project

The InDiCo: Increase Digital Competences to Promote Inclusion project is an Erasmus+ funded initiative aimed at fostering the digital inclusion of persons with learning difficulties across Europe. In an increasingly digital society, this group risks being marginalised due to barriers in accessing and using digital technologies – barriers that affect their participation in education, employment, social services, and everyday life. The project responds to the European Commission’s digital strategy, which sets a target of ensuring that at least 80 % of EU citizens aged 16–74 have basic digital skills by 2030, and recognises that persons with learning difficulties are particularly vulnerable to exclusion from this objective.

The project addresses the identified gaps by developing tailored methodologies and tools that enable competence-based assessment, training and validation of digital skills and by supporting educators and organisations in adopting inclusive approaches that align with the EU’s Digital Competence Framework for Citizens (DigComp).

What to expect

The conference will feature:

  • Opening remarks from the European Economic and Social Committee (EESC)
  • A keynote speech by David Mekkaoui (All Digital) setting the scene for digital inclusion
  • An engaging panel discussion on rethinking digital competences for inclusive societies, followed by audience Q&A
  • A presentation of the InDiCo project achievements, including its competence framework, methodology, and training approach
  • Testimonials from participants and educators sharing real-life learning journeys
  • A session on the future of digital inclusion, including policy recommendations

Participants will also have opportunities to take part in interactive moments, exchange experiences, and connect with stakeholders working at the intersection of digital skills and inclusion.
